Operating without a certificate of registration issued by the administrator; Abandoning or failing to perform, without justification, any contract or project engaged in or undertaken by a registered contractor or subcontractor, or deviating from or disregarding plans or specifications in any material respect without the consent of the owner; Failing to creditthe owner for any payment they have made to the contractor or his salesperson in connection with a residential contracting transaction; Making any material misrepresentation in the procurement of a contract by making any false promise of a characteristic likely to influence, persuade or induce the procurement of a contract; Knowingly contracting beyond the scope of the registration as a contractor or subcontractor; Acting directly, regardless of the receipt or the expectation of receipt of compensation or gain from the mortgage lender, in connection with a residential contracting transaction by preparing, offering, or negotiating or attempting to or agreeing to prepare, arrange, offer or negotiate a mortgage loan on behalf of a mortgage lender; Acting as a mortgage broker or agent for any mortgage lender; Publishing, directly or indirectly, any advertisement relating to home construction or home improvements which does not contain the contractor's or subcontractor's certificate of registration number or which does contain an assertion, representation, or statement of fact which is false, deceptive, or misleading; Advertising in any manner that a registrant is registered under this chapter unless the advertisement includes an accurate reference to the contractor's or subcontractor's certificate of registration; Violations of the building laws of the Commonwealth or of any political subdivision thereof; Misrepresenting a material fact by an applicant in obtaining a certificate of registration; Failing to notify the administrator of any change of trade name or address as required by Section 13; Conducting a residential contracting business in any name other than the one in which a contractor or subcontractor is registered; Failing to pay for materials or services rendered in connection with his operating as a contractor or subcontractor where he has received sufficient funds as payment for the particular construction work, project or operation for which the services or materials were rendered or purchased; Failing to comply with any order, demand or requirement lawfully made by the administrator or fund administrator under and within the authority of this chapter; Demanding or receiving payment in violation of clause (6) of paragraph (a) of section two which states: "a time schedule of payments to be made under said contract and the amount of each payment stated in dollars, including all finance charges. A contractor or subcontractor is responsible for the conduct of employees, salespersons, and subcontractors within the scope of their contract with the owner, All building permits shall clearly state that persons contracting with unregistered contractors do not have access to the Guaranty Fund, Provisions can be made in the contract for contractors to use alternative dispute resolution through a private arbitration services program approved by the Office of Consumer Affairs and Business Regulation, Action to enforce provisions of this law or to seek damages can be brought in superior court, the district court or in a small claims court, Contractors/subcontractors cannot act as mortgage brokers or represent lenders. A permit is not needed to build a one-story detached building (such as a shed) provided the floor area doesnt exceed 120 square feet, fences no taller than six feet, and some retaining walls. Under s.R113.4 of the 7th Edition of the Massachusetts State Building Code, 780 CMR, violation of any provision of 780 CMR shall be punishable by a fine of not more than $1,000 or by imprisonment for not more than one (1) year, or both for each violation. According to the Massachusetts State Building Code (780 CMR, Section R105.1), building permits are required to construct, re-construct, alter, repair, remove, or demolish a building or structure; or to change the use or occupancy of a building or structure; or to install or alter any equipment for which provision is made or the installation of which is regulated by the Massachusetts State Building Code. This means that a permit is needed to cut away any wall or load-bearing support, such as a column, and to change or remove any means of egress or the supporting structure around it.
